What are the benefits of outsourcing software development?

Software development outsourcing lets companies hire external developers or teams to build their applications and systems. You gain access to global talent at lower costs while maintaining quality through proper management. This approach helps businesses scale quickly, reduce expenses, and focus on their core activities while experts handle the technical work.

What exactly is software development outsourcing and how does it work?

Software development outsourcing means hiring external developers or companies to build your applications instead of using internal staff. You delegate programming tasks to specialists outside your organization who work remotely or from different locations.

Three main outsourcing models exist. Offshore outsourcing involves working with teams in distant countries with significant time zone differences, often offering the lowest costs. Nearshore outsourcing connects you with developers in nearby countries with similar time zones and cultural backgrounds. Onshore outsourcing uses local developers within your country, providing easy communication but typically higher costs.

The outsourcing process starts when you define your project requirements and budget. You then research potential partners, evaluate their expertise, and request proposals. After selecting a provider, you establish communication channels, project management methods, and delivery timelines. The external team begins development while maintaining regular updates and milestone reviews until project completion.

Why do companies choose to outsource their software development?

Companies outsource software development primarily to reduce costs, access specialized talent, and accelerate project timelines. IT uitbesteden allows businesses to focus on their core activities while experts handle technical challenges they cannot solve internally.

Cost reduction drives many outsourcing decisions. Local developers often command high salaries, especially for specialized skills like machine learning or blockchain development. Outsourcing provides access to equally skilled developers at lower hourly rates, significantly reducing project budgets.

Access to global talent solves skill shortages that many companies face. You might need expertise in specific programming languages or frameworks that local developers lack. Software uitbesteden opens doors to worldwide talent pools with diverse technical backgrounds and experience levels.

Faster time-to-market becomes possible when outsourcing partners can start immediately instead of waiting months to recruit and train internal staff. Many outsourcing teams work across different time zones, potentially enabling round-the-clock development progress.

Scalability benefits allow you to adjust team sizes based on project needs without long-term employment commitments. You can quickly add developers during busy periods and scale down when projects are completed, maintaining optimal resource allocation.

What are the main cost benefits of outsourcing software development?

Software development outsourcing typically reduces costs by 40–60% compared to hiring local developers. You eliminate recruitment expenses, training costs, and ongoing employment benefits while accessing skilled developers at competitive hourly rates.

Salary savings represent the most significant cost advantage. Local senior developers might cost €80–120 per hour, while experienced outsourced developers often work for €25–50 per hour. This difference allows you to hire multiple specialists for the price of one local developer.

Recruitment costs disappear when you outsource. Finding good developers takes months and involves advertising, interviewing, and onboarding expenses. IT outsourcing Nederland providers handle recruitment, letting you start projects immediately with pre-vetted talent.

Infrastructure investments become unnecessary when working with outsourced teams. You avoid purchasing development tools, software licenses, and hardware for additional staff. The outsourcing partner provides all necessary resources and maintains its own technical infrastructure.

Hidden employment costs like health insurance, pension contributions, and office space requirements add 30–40% to local developer salaries. Outsourcing eliminates these expenses since you pay only for actual development work completed.

How does outsourcing help you access better talent and expertise?

Outsourcing software development connects you to global talent pools with specialized skills that might be unavailable locally. You gain access to developers with specific expertise in emerging technologies, niche programming languages, and industry-specific solutions.

Global talent access means you can find developers experienced in any technology stack. Whether you need React Native mobile developers, AWS cloud specialists, or machine learning engineers, outsourcing partners maintain teams with diverse technical backgrounds and proven track records.

Specialized skill availability becomes particularly valuable for complex projects. Local markets might lack developers experienced in specific frameworks like Flutter for cross-platform development or expertise in particular industries like fintech or healthcare software.

Experience levels vary widely in outsourcing teams, allowing you to match developer seniority to task complexity. You can assign senior architects to system design while junior developers handle routine coding tasks, optimizing both quality and costs.

A continuous learning culture characterizes many outsourcing companies that invest heavily in keeping their developers up to date with the latest technologies. This means you often get access to cutting-edge knowledge and best practices that might not exist in your local market.

What challenges should you expect when outsourcing software development?

Software development outsourcing presents challenges including communication barriers, time zone differences, and quality control concerns. However, proper planning and management strategies can effectively address these obstacles and ensure project success.

Communication barriers arise from language differences and cultural misunderstandings. Technical concepts might get lost in translation, leading to incorrect implementations. Address this by establishing clear communication protocols, using visual documentation, and ensuring your outsourcing partner has strong English skills.

Time zone differences can slow down problem resolution and daily collaboration. When your team works while the development team sleeps, urgent issues might wait hours for responses. Mitigate this by scheduling overlapping work hours and establishing clear escalation procedures for critical problems.

Quality control becomes more complex when you cannot directly observe development work. You need robust testing procedures, code review processes, and regular milestone demonstrations to maintain standards. Implement automated testing and continuous integration to catch issues early.

Cultural differences affect work styles, communication preferences, and business practices. Some cultures avoid saying “no” directly, potentially hiding project difficulties. Build relationships with your outsourcing team and create a safe environment for honest communication about challenges.

Project management complexity increases when coordinating remote teams across different locations. Use collaborative tools, maintain detailed documentation, and establish regular check-in schedules to keep projects on track.

How do you choose the right software development outsourcing partner?

Choose software development outsourcing partners based on technical expertise, communication skills, and cultural fit rather than just cost. Evaluate their portfolio, development processes, and client references to ensure they can deliver quality work that meets your specific requirements.

Technical expertise assessment should focus on relevant experience with your technology stack and similar projects. Review their portfolio for applications resembling your requirements and ask detailed questions about their development approaches, testing methods, and quality assurance processes.

Communication skills matter enormously for project success. Test their responsiveness, English proficiency, and ability to explain technical concepts clearly. Good outsourcing partners ask clarifying questions and provide regular updates without being prompted.

Their project management approach reveals how organized and reliable the partner will be. Look for teams using established methodologies like Agile or Scrum, with clear processes for requirements gathering, progress tracking, and change management.

Cultural fit affects long-term working relationships and project outcomes. Consider their business hours, work style preferences, and willingness to adapt to your company culture and processes.

The pricing structure should be transparent and aligned with your budget expectations. Avoid partners offering unrealistically low rates, as this often indicates quality compromises. Instead, focus on value delivery and total project costs, including potential revisions and support.

Portfolio assessment helps verify their capabilities and experience level. Look for diverse projects demonstrating technical competence and ask for references from recent clients who can share honest feedback about their experience working together.
